Find the units of displacement (translation) of the point (4,2) to get the image of (7,7). Chapter (transformation) (coordinates) (translation). Step by step answer please.

Respuesta :

Answer:

The rule of the translation will be:

(x, y) → (x+3, y+5)

Step-by-step explanation:

Translation of an object is basically termed as "sliding" the original. If the image is moved right by the 'c' units, the 'c' unit(s) are added to the x-coordinate and if the image is moved left by the 'c' units, the 'c' unit(s) are subtracted to the x-coordinate.

And If the image is moved up by the 'c' units, the 'c' unit(s) are added to the y-coordinate and if the image is moved down by the 'c' units, the 'c' unit(s) are subtracted to the x-coordinate.

As the point is (4, 2)

The image of the point is (7, 7)

As the coordinates of the image point indicate that 3 units are added to the x-coordinate of the original point, and 5 units are added to the ý-coordinate.

Hence, the image will be move 3 units to the right and 5 units up.

Therefore, the rule of the translation will be:

(x, y)  →  (x+3, y+5)

as

(4, 2) →  (x+3, y+5) = (4+3, 2+5) = (7, 7)
